Former lawmaker Son Hye-won, who was accused of making a second-name investment after receiving the development information of Mokpo City in advance, was sentenced to a prison sentence of 1 year and 6 months by the court of first instance. There was no legal restraint in order to guarantee the right to defend, but the court said the crime was a serious corruption that greatly undermined public confidence.

In June of last year, the prosecution prosecuted former lawmaker Son Hye-won and applied two charges of violating the Anti-Corruption Act and the Real Name Act.

In May and September 2017, Mokpo City was charged with purchasing real estate under the name of an acquaintance after receiving the data of the urban regeneration project in Mokpo City, and was also charged with buying the real estate under the second name. Sentenced.

In order to guarantee the right to defend, there was no legal arrest.

The court explained the reason for the sentence, saying, "The lawmakers, who must possess strict morality and integrity, used the secrets they had learned during work to anticipate market price increases and acquired real estate, which greatly undermined the trust of public officials."

It was also evaluated as "a major corruption that must be corrected in our society, which must create an intact public service society."

However, since the data received by former Congressman Son cannot be viewed as a secret after the announcement by the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ure and Transport in December 2017, the court judged that the purchase of real estate was not guilty.

Rep. Sohn expressed his intention to appeal through social media, saying, "It is difficult to understand the conviction. I will do my best to inform the substantive truth."
